Chargers Delay Omarion Hampton’s Return Until After Week 12 Bye
Los Angeles will lean on Kimani Vidal, with front-office evaluations of backfield depth continuing before Tuesday’s trade deadline.
Overview
- Jim Harbaugh said he does not expect to open Hampton’s IR activation window until after the Week 12 bye, setting a earliest return target of Week 13.
- Hampton has been on injured reserve with an ankle injury since Week 5 and, despite eligibility in Week 10, is now expected to miss Weeks 10 and 11.
- Kimani Vidal continues to handle lead duties with help from Hassan Haskins and Jaret Patterson, filling in while the rookie recovers.
- Reports indicate the Chargers are exploring running back options before the NFL trade deadline on Nov. 4 at 4 p.m. ET.
- Los Angeles is 6-3 and remains in the playoff mix despite losing Najee Harris to a season-ending Achilles injury earlier in the year.
